Stemme Baby Care Nigeria Limited is a purpose-driven manufacturing company focused on producing safe, affordable, and innovative baby care products, especially baby beds designed for comfort, hygiene, and infant safety.

We address the challenge of unsafe sleeping conditions and expensive imported products by manufacturing locally, making quality baby care accessible to more African families. Our products are thoughtfully designed to support healthy infant development while giving parents peace of mind.

A key part of our innovation is the use of recycled plastic waste in producing components of our baby beds, helping to reduce environmental pollution and lower our carbon footprint. This circular approach not only supports climate sustainability but also reduces production costs, allowing us to maintain affordability without compromising quality.

Beyond products, Stemme Baby Care contributes to job creation, supports local supply chains, and promotes sustainable manufacturing practices in Nigeria. Our long-term vision is to become a leading African brand in baby care, improving infant health outcomes while driving environmental and economic impact across the continent.
